There are actually only three main rock types (sedimentary, igneous, and metamorphic), and while fossils are found in all of them, they are not found only very rarely in the latter two. Sedimentary rocks are formed from material that is laid down in water and hardened. read more

There are four types of fossils: mold fossils, cast fossils, trace fossils and true form fossils. Fossils are divided into two distinct categories: fossilized body parts, such as teeth, claws, bones and embryos, and fossilized traces, including nests, tooth marks, droppings and footprints. read more
